Can you survive the loss of a child?

Patricia Meier knows you can because she’s lived it. She lived through 15 months of caring for her five year old daughter with brain cancer. She lived through the loss of her child and her marriage. She’s lived through fielding helpful suggestions from friends and family, through navigating the medical system, and through putting her life back together. She has survived devastating loss, and now thrives as she keeps her daughter’s memory close to her heart.

There is hope. This is her story.

Patricia Meier’s wish to have a daughter finally came true. All those wishes on birthday cakes and falling stars, answered at last. The morning of December 6, 2001, Alexandra Avis Kennedy was born. She had beautiful blue eyes and the fingers of a pianist. She was a dainty little blonde and perfect in every way. Patricia’s heart’s desire had come true.

Four short years later, the dream turned into a nightmare, after Patricia received the devastating news that Alexandra had a life-threatening brain tumour; one that eventually took her life.

This is a mother’s journey from the darkness back to the light. The spirit of intent in sharing this story is to provide hope for others who find themselves in similar dire straits, to provide hope during the hard times, and to let you know there is life and joy to be had again at the end of this dark night.
